Performance of printing based on detected end portions of medium

1. A printing apparatus comprising:
a printing section;
a transport belt that is configured to transport a print medium that is placed on a transport belt;
a controller and;
a camera that is configured to capture an image of an area that covers a whole width of the transport belt to thereby generate a captured image that includes imaging of both end portions of the print medium in an intersecting direction that intersects a transport direction of the print medium, the printing apparatus configured to provide the captured image to the controller;
the controller configured to detect a position of both end portions of the print medium by evaluating the captured image based on a color difference in the captured image between an image color of the transport belt and an image color of the print medium, the controller further configured to cause the printing section to execute printing based on print data while one end portion of the both end portions detected by the sensor is set as a print start position and a distance from one end portion to the other end portion is set as width of the print medium;
wherein, the detection of the position of both end portions of the print medium being performed by: determining a right end portion of the print medium as captured in the captured image is separated from the right end of the captured image by a first number of pixels to the left;
and determining a left end portion of the print medium as captured in the captured image is separated from the left end of the captured image by a second number of pixels to the right;
calculating a first distance in the intersecting direction from the right end portion of the print medium to a right side of the transport belt based on the first number of pixels;
and calculating a second distance in the intersecting direction from the left end portion of the print medium to a left side of the transport belt based on the second number of pixels.
